WebGrasses are classified according to heading date – which is the date on which 50% of the ears in fertile tillers have emerged. Early varieties of ryegrass reach their heading date in the first two weeks of May; intermediate varieties head during the second half of May and late varieties reach this stage during the first two weeks of June.
